Culture & Arts · BarnetBarbican Estate Ranks Second in Time Out’s 2026 Global Beauty List
Time Out London’s 2026 guide placed the Barbican Estate second among the world’s most beautiful buildings, only behind the Taj Mahal. The estate, Grade II-listed since 2001, is set for a £240 million redesign starting in 2027 that will add a new wayfinding system.

WorldLenny’s New Haven Pizza Returns to Covent Garden This Autumn
Lenny’s, the New Haven-style pizza pop-up that closed last year after a run at Finsbury Park’s The Bedford Tavern, is set to open a permanent restaurant in Covent Garden this autumn. Founder Max Lewis is partnering with MJMK Restaurants, and the menu will feature a tomato pie and a hybrid 'Lenny' pizza.
